Nigerian Afrobeats star David Adeleke, popularly known as Davido, has formally aligned with the Accord Party, following the recent political realignment of his uncle, Osun State Governor Ademola Adeleke.


The musician confirmed his decision on Tuesday via his verified X (formerly Twitter) account, announcing plans to travel to Osogbo, the Osun State capital, to collect his party membership card.


Davido said he would complete the process at the state government house, popularly known as Imole House.


His announcement comes weeks after Governor Adeleke adopted the Accord Party as his new political platform ahead of the 2026 Osun governorship election. The governor officially defected from the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) on December 9, 2025, during a ceremony held at the Banquet Hall of the Government House in Osogbo, attended by party leaders and supporters.


Explaining his defection at the time, Adeleke cited internal leadership disputes at the national level of the PDP. He stated that the decision followed consultations with political stakeholders and opinion leaders, adding that he formally joined the Accord Party on November 6 as part of preparations for his re-election bid.


Davido had earlier reacted publicly to his uncle’s resignation from the PDP by reposting the announcement on social media with a brief caption, signaling support for the move.


The singer’s entry into partisan politics further highlights the growing intersection between Nigeria’s entertainment industry and its political landscape.
